final在java中有什么作用

avatar
作者
猴君
阅读量:0

在Java中,final关键字可以用来修饰类、方法和变量,其作用如下:

  1. 修饰类:final修饰的类表示该类不能被继承,即不能有子类。
final class MyClass {     // class body } 
  1. 修饰方法:final修饰的方法表示该方法不能被子类重写,即不能有子类重写该方法。
class MyClass {     final void myMethod() {         // method body     } } 
  1. 修饰变量:final修饰的变量表示该变量只能被赋值一次,即为常量。常量一旦被赋值后就不能再被修改。
final int MY_CONSTANT = 10; 

总的来说,final关键字用来表示不可改变的、最终的状态或行为。通过使用final关键字可以增强代码的安全性和可读性,避免不必要的修改和继承。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!